About Lijuan Meng
Lijuan Meng is a scholar working on Cancer Research,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Oncology, having authored 40 papers that have together received 570 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Graphene research and applications (7 papers), 2D Materials and Applications (6 papers), Lung Cancer Treatments and Mutations (5 papers), MXene and MAX Phase Materials (5 papers), Ferroptosis and cancer prognosis (3 papers), Gut microbiota and health (3 papers), Colorectal Cancer Treatments and Studies (3 papers) and RNA modifications and cancer (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cancer Research (87 citations), Materials Chemistry (235 citations) and Molecular Biology (189 citations). Lijuan Meng has collaborated with scholars based in China, Hong Kong and Netherlands. Frequent co-authors include Jinlan Wang, Feng Ding, Qing Sun, Shijun Yuan, Yanan Li, Jian Jiang, Shuguang Fang, Zixuan Ye, Min Yang and Jianguo Zhu. Their work appears in journals such as The Journal of Physical Chemistry C, Carbohydrate Polymers, Physical Chemistry Chemical Physics, Journal of Clinical Oncology and Blood.
